Management Commentary
Management remarks during the recent earnings call focused on core operational and portfolio priorities for DWS (KTF). Leadership noted that credit quality across the fund’s underlying holdings remains a top priority, with the vast majority of the fund’s positions carrying investment-grade credit ratings, and limited exposure to higher-risk municipal project segments that have faced elevated market scrutiny in recent months. Management also addressed questions related to the fund’s distribution policy, noting that current distribution levels are supported by the underlying yield of the existing portfolio, and that ongoing operational efficiency efforts have helped keep fund expenses aligned with peer group averages for comparable municipal income products. Leadership also confirmed that the fund has not made any material shifts to its sector allocation in the recent quarter, as they evaluate potential entry points for new positions amid market volatility.

Forward Guidance
DWS (KTF) leadership provided conditional, market-dependent forward guidance during the call, avoiding fixed quantitative targets in line with the variable nature of fixed income market conditions. Leadership noted that future distribution levels would likely be tied to prevailing yields on new municipal debt purchases, as well as any shifts to central bank interest rate policy in the upcoming months. They added that the fund may adjust its portfolio duration positioning in response to shifting rate expectations, to balance the competing priorities of consistent income generation and mitigation of potential price volatility for underlying holdings. Management emphasized that any future portfolio adjustments would prioritize capital preservation for unitholders, while seeking to maintain competitive tax-exempt income levels relative to other low-risk fixed income asset classes.

Market Reaction
Following the earnings release, KTF saw normal trading activity in public markets, with trading volumes in line with recent average levels for the fund. Analysts covering the closed-end municipal fund space have noted that the reported results were largely aligned with broad market expectations for funds in this category, with no major surprises flagged in either the financial results or management commentary. Some analysts have highlighted the fund’s long track record of consistent credit quality as a potential positive attribute for risk-averse investors seeking tax-exempt income, while others have noted that KTF could face headwinds if market expectations for rate cuts materialize in the upcoming months, which may pressure yields for new portfolio additions. No widespread revisions to analyst outlooks for the fund were announced in the immediate aftermath of the earnings release.
